« Gnupg / gpg cheatsheet » : différence entre les versions

De Linux Server Wiki
Aller à la navigation Aller à la recherche
Aucun résumé des modifications
Ligne 1 : Ligne 1 :
Export gpg :
=Fingerprint=
 
* D'une clé :
<pre>gpg --fingerprint <id/mail/fichier contenant une clé></pre>
 
* d'une clé et ses sous clés :
<pre>gpg --fringerprint --fingerprint <id/mail/fichier contenant une clé><pre>
 
=Export gpg=
 
Notez que l’exportation d'une clé privé exporte la clé privée et publique (la clé publique est
<pre>
<pre>
gpg -a --export pfoo@domain.tld > pfoo@domain.tld-public-gpg.key
gpg --output pfoo@domain.tld-public.gpg -a --export <id/mail/nom>
gpg -a --export-secret-keys pfoo@domain.tld > pfoo@domain.tld-secret-gpg.key
gpg --output pfoo@domain.tld-secret.gpg -a --export-secret-keys <id/mail/nom>
gpg --export-ownertrust > ownertrust-gpg.txt
gpg --export-ownertrust > ownertrust-gpg.txt
</pre>
</pre>


import :
=import=
On importe que la clé privé, car elle contient la clé publique
 
<pre>
<pre>
gpg --import  pfoo@domain.tld-secret-gpg.key
gpg --import  pfoo@domain.tld-secret.gpg
gpg --import-ownertrust ownertrust-gpg.txt
gpg --import-ownertrust ownertrust-gpg.txt
</pre>
Méthode manuelle :
<pre>
cp ~/.gnupg/pubring.gpg /backup/path/
cp ~/.gnupg/secring.gpg /backup/path/
cp ~/.gnupg/trustdb.gpg /backup/path/
</pre>
</pre>


=Vérifier les clés présentes=
=Vérifier les clés présentes=
Liste des clés publiques :
* Liste des clés publiques :
<pre>gpg --list-keys</pre>
<pre>gpg --list-keys</pre>
<pre>gpg -k</pre>


Liste des clés privés :
* Liste des clés privés :
<pre>gpg --list-secret-keys</pre>
<pre>gpg --list-secret-keys</pre>
<pre>gpg -K</pre>

Version du 29 mai 2017 à 17:53

Fingerprint

  • D'une clé :
gpg --fingerprint <id/mail/fichier contenant une clé>
  • d'une clé et ses sous clés :
gpg --fringerprint --fingerprint <id/mail/fichier contenant une clé><pre>

=Export gpg=

Notez que l’exportation d'une clé privé exporte la clé privée et publique (la clé publique est 
<pre>
gpg --output pfoo@domain.tld-public.gpg -a --export <id/mail/nom>
gpg --output pfoo@domain.tld-secret.gpg -a --export-secret-keys <id/mail/nom>
gpg --export-ownertrust > ownertrust-gpg.txt

import

gpg --import  pfoo@domain.tld-secret.gpg
gpg --import-ownertrust ownertrust-gpg.txt

Vérifier les clés présentes

  • Liste des clés publiques :
gpg --list-keys
gpg -k
  • Liste des clés privés :
gpg --list-secret-keys
gpg -K